膝关节置换螺旋CT扫描技术初步经验 被引量:1

Preliminary Experience of Joint Replacement-Knee by Spiral CT

摘要 目的:探讨膝关节置换常规CT扫描条件的初步经验。方法:对25名成年膝关节置换患者在前后2次CT申请检查中实行适度增加曝光剂量和层厚的扫描,对比同一患者前后2次扫描所得图像中金属伪影、密度分辨率的情况。结果:患者第2次扫描图像的金属伪影得到了明显的抑制,密度分辨率得到了提高。结论:适度提高曝光剂量,可一定程度上改善图像中金属伪影的影响,提高密度分辨率。提高层厚降低了患者的辐射剂量。同时增大曝光量对处理金属伪影与密度分辨率在层厚方面的矛盾起到了重要的权衡价值。 Objective To investigate the effect of CT exposure dose to balance metal artifact and density resolution.Methods In the 25 patients' twice CT scans,we increased the exposure dose and slice thickness.Then contrasted the same patient's metal artifact,density resolution.Results The second time image of every patient bates metal artifact clearly and improves the density resolution in a certain extent.Conclusion Reasonably increasing the exposure dose can bate metal artifact and improve the density resolution in a certain extent.Increasing the CT exposure dose balances metal artifact and density resolution on the slice thickness.
